Latest Patents

Kinoshita's latest patents include innovative designs for battery devices. One of his patents describes a battery device that features a battery pack, a circuit substrate for acquiring battery information, and a switch that controls the input and output of electric power. This design incorporates a heat radiator made from thermally conductive material, ensuring effective heat transfer from the switch. Another patent outlines a battery pack that consists of an assembled battery with battery cells, a battery case, and a wiring case. This design includes an elastic member that enhances safety by interacting with a safety valve on the battery cell.
